From Friday, April 17, 5:00 PM to 11:00 PM, the beer pub TWO KINGS at Kachidoki Sun Square B1F announced its business hours. The post also noted that the chalkboard lineup changes about once a week, and that day's selection featured 38 craft beers. It was a setup designed for wide-ranging tastings, combining tap beers with cans and bottles.

On tap were `WEST COAST Brewing`'s `APPLES APPLES` (Hard Apple Cider) and `Pinata Pale Ale`, `Shiga Kogen Beer`'s `Sono Juu`, `Y.Market Brewing`'s `FANTASMA`, and `BREAKEDGE BEER WORKS`' `SAVE`. The post also mentioned that `Y.Market Brewing`'s `Uma Uma Hazy IPA` had been added, along with rotating arrivals of hop-forward Hazy IPAs.

In cans and bottles, there were barrel-aged and other aged beers such as `Tamamura Honten (Shiga Kogen Beer)`'s `Yamabushi Extra Quadrupel`, `Yamabushi ore no sake ga nome ne no ka / grand cru #2`, and `Yamabushi red`, as well as `Uchu Brewing`'s `Uchu IPA`, `B.M.B Brewery`'s `HIGASHIE` / `Amethyst Eye` / `Ruby Tint`, `FLORA FERMENTATION`'s `Flora Lager` / `Raven` / `Scylla` / `Lupus` / `Tayu`, and even `FC Tokyo Pale Ale` from `Ise Kadoya Beer x FC Tokyo`.

In Kachidoki, TWO KINGS' strength is its breadth, covering everything from lagers to Hazy IPAs, sours, porters, and barrel-aged styles.
